Massachusetts: Boston Public Health study finds flu’s second wave hits multiple age groups
Boston MA–As spring turned to autumn in Boston, the 2009 H1N1 influenza virus moved from children and teens to older age groups, virtually disappeared from some neighborhoods but hung around in others, and continued to disproportionately impact communities of color, according to a new study released today by the Boston Public Health Commission.

Massachusetts: DPH releases results of South Boston scleroderma and lupus health study
Boston MA–The Massachusetts Department of Public Health (DPH) has released the results of an investigation into the occurrence of scleroderma and lupus, two rare chronic diseases, in South Boston. The investigation found that the prevalence of scleroderma was indeed statistically significantly higher than expected among Caucasian females. No specific associations with environmental exposures were identified.
